OBJECTIVE
Competition between companies have passed through various phases where cost and quality played a major role in providing competitive edge. The design, development and introduction of new products to satisfy customers play a critical role in the success or failure of companies. The process of managing this crucial activity of recognizing the customer needs and wants, conceptualizing them, materialising those concepts into concrete designs of products and processes in a way that they can economically and reliably be produced and introduced to the market at the right time, is most critical activity of modern industrial activity.

This course is designed to introduce some key concepts and tools for improving customer satisfaction through products or services development. The Kano concept shows how to think about expected, one-dimensional, and exciting quality. Quality function deployment (QFD) shows how to prioritize customer demands and develop breakthroughs in products and service. The voice of the customer and the voice of the engineer is geared to integrating the wants of the customer with the existing organization know-how. This helps organization develop products and services that attract customers and grow market share.
